Rhododendron, Oregon
Located on the historic Barlow Trail and just minutes away from great hiking, biking, skiing, and golfing on beautiful Mt. Hood, this spacious and cozy custom built home sits on 2.5 private acres that make for a perfect mountain getaway. Facing south on a hilltop, the house gets a lot of light yet it is surrounded by a thick cedar and fir forest. The partially covered 500 square foot wraparound deck and huge picture window in the living room offer an amazing view of Hunchback Mountain. On clear evenings you will enjoy gazing at the star-filled sky from our new Tiger River Sumatran hot tub. The hot tub is conveniently located just steps away from the master bedroom but is also easily accessible from the wraparound deck. Both bedrooms have been outfitted with your comfort in mind and the kitchen is fully equipped for gourmet meals. Built with love and with trees milled from the property, this modern home contains so much mountain charm.
We have outfitted the house with your relaxation and comfort in mind. Each bedroom has luxurious linens and is adjacent to its own full bath. The master bedroom has a Sealy Serta king size bed and is just steps away from the hot tub. The kitchen is fully stocked for all your gourmet cooking needs. We love to cook ourselves, so we promise to always keep the knives sharpened! There is also a charcoal grill for cooking on the deck or for the more adventurous, the firepit on the west side of the property. The house is heated with a wonderfully efficient wood stove that adds so much to the coziness of the place. We provide a free wireless Internet connection, a landline phone, and an iPod player.
